Disappointed

Pros: I was impressed with the size of the heatsink and the fan. Looks good and I liked the fact that the bracket is mounted first and the unit is secured with 4 screws. Felt solid on the motherboard.
Cons: Installed it on an Asus P5Q Pro motherboard with E8400 processor and .it did not make contact with the CPU. Nearly fried the CPU before I realized the problem. Removed the heatsink and none of the pre-applied thermal compound had contacted the CPU. Mounting bracket is is thin and prone to cracking if you have to remove it for any reason.
Overall Review: Too inexpensive to return. It was worth a try at the price and no shipping.
Another awesome board from Asus

Pros: Nice layout. Clean looking, quality board. One of very few boards with all the features I need. The PS2 connections for both mouse and keyboard allowed me to continue using my existing KVM switch. Worked just like the 4 previous Asus boards that I installed in my rigs.
Cons: Comes with only 2 SATA cables (as noted in Package Contents). I/O shield is flimsy. The BIOS update instructions (new 0412 BIOS posted on Asus website) provided in user guide did not work for me but I was able to install it.
Overall Review: I am not a gamer and I do not overclock. Arctic Freezer 7 Pro installed without touching the memory but if I had to remove DIMM A1, I would have to remove the fan from the heatsink first. Not a show stopper. Don’t take the QVL as gospel. The WD HDD and the DVR were not listed and work just fine. Would not hesitate to buy it again or recommend it.
